Alamo Placita is a little neighborhood in central Denver where running into neighbors at the local park or at Pablo's Coffee is the norm. The cornerstone of the neighborhood is a spectacular flower garden in Alamo Placita Park located on Speer Boulevard and Ogden Street. 1920s Bungalows, 1890s Victorians and Denver Squares built just after [...]
